技术文摘
前端开发之 JavaScript 变量命名系列
前端开发之 JavaScript 变量命名系列
在前端开发中,JavaScript 变量命名是一项至关重要的技能。一个清晰、准确且富有意义的变量名能够极大地提高代码的可读性、可维护性和可理解性。
良好的变量命名能够清晰地传达变量的用途和功能。例如,如果我们要存储用户的年龄,使用“userAge”这样的变量名就比简单的“a”或“x”更具描述性。当其他开发者阅读我们的代码时,能够迅速理解变量的含义,从而更轻松地理解整个代码逻辑。
变量命名应遵循一定的规则和最佳实践。使用有意义的单词或短语。避免使用模糊、抽象或过于简洁的名称。采用驼峰命名法(CamelCase)或下划线命名法(snake_case),保持命名风格的一致性。例如,“userName”(驼峰命名法)和“user_name”(下划线命名法)都是常见且规范的命名方式。
在命名变量时,要注意避免与 JavaScript 中的保留关键字冲突。保留关键字具有特定的功能和用途,如果将变量命名为这些关键字,可能会导致代码出错。
另外,考虑变量的作用域也很重要。对于全局变量,应使用更具描述性和唯一性的名称,以避免与其他模块或文件中的变量产生冲突。而对于局部变量,可以根据其在特定函数或代码块中的用途进行简洁但清晰的命名。
为了提高代码的可维护性,变量命名还应反映出代码的变更和扩展。如果一个变量的用途发生了变化,及时更新其名称以准确反映新的功能。
JavaScript 变量命名是前端开发中不可忽视的重要环节。通过遵循规范和最佳实践,使用清晰、准确且富有意义的变量名,我们能够编写出更易于理解、维护和扩展的高质量前端代码,提高开发效率,减少错误,并为团队协作打下坚实的基础。无论是新手开发者还是经验丰富的工程师,都应始终重视变量命名这一基本技能,不断提升自己的编码水平,为创造出更优秀的前端应用而努力。
TAGS: 前端开发 JavaScript 变量 变量命名 命名系列
- Python 中的数据相关性分析实践
- 31 道 Java 核心面试题 一次性打包予你
- 用可视化动图逐步阐释栈的作用
- do{}while(0)仅执行一次就无意义?或许你并未理解!
- 一个小技巧,使 Python 代码运行效率暴增 17 倍
- 阿粉万字长文解析 ThreadPoolExecutor
- Python 虽佳,切勿盲目用于每个项目!
- HashMap 源码中红黑树的逐行解读
- 停止把对象用于 JavaScript 中的哈希映射
- 为您献艺,带来一段相声
- 6 款必知的 Web 开发工具
- 探索 JavaScript 中的 ES 模块
- Git 分支模式的选择之道
- Java 与 Python:未来谁更胜一筹?
- 开发人员应深知这些术语中的细微差别